History

A Leviathan Blossom is a special flower that grows exclusively in Purgatory. Combined with myrrh, cassia, and rockrose, it's nectar is one of the necessary ingredients for a spell designed to bind God, just as he and the archangels bound the Darkness.

Episodes

15.08 Our Father, Who Aren't in Heaven

After learning the truth about Chuck from Castiel, Michael gives him and Dean a spell with a list of ingredients that can bind God in his weakened state. One of which is the nectar of a Leviathan Blossom, which grows exclusively in Purgatory. To retrieve the flower, Michael opens a rift to Purgatory for Dean and Castiel that will last for 12 hours.
